The 74HCT164T14-13 is a serial-in, parallel-out shift register integrated circuit chip. Some of the advantages and application scenarios of this chip are as follows:Advantages: 1. Simple operation: The chip has a serial input pin, clock input, and a clear input pin, making it easy to interface with microcontrollers or other digital devices. 2. High-speed operation: The HCT series chips are known for their high-speed operation, which makes them suitable for applications that require quick data transfer. 3. Low power consumption: The 74HCT164T14-13 operates at lower power levels, making it energy-efficient.Application scenarios: 1. Data storage and retrieval: The shift register can store a stream of bits and deliver them to the parallel output pins in a sequential manner. This functionality makes it useful for applications that require serial-to-parallel data conversion, such as LED displays or input devices with limited pins. 2. Shift registers: The chip can be cascaded with other shift registers to increase the number of output bits. This feature makes it ideal for applications that require a larger number of outputs, such as controlling multiple LEDs or driving a display. 3. Data buffering: The 74HCT164T14-13 chip can be used as a buffer to store data temporarily while the microcontroller or processing unit handles other tasks. This helps prevent data loss and improves the overall system performance.Overall, the 74HCT164T14-13 chip is versatile and finds applications in various areas where serial data manipulation and parallel output is required.
